Pramoedya Ananta Toer (1925-2006) was a prominent Indonesian author and activist, renowned for his powerful literary works that address themes of colonialism, social justice, and human rights. His most famous work, the Buru Quartet, is a series of novels that delve into Indonesia's history and the struggles of its people, showcasing his deep understanding of both the sociopolitical landscape and the human condition. Despite facing censorship and imprisonment under the Suharto regime, Pramoedya's writings inspired generations of readers and thinkers, making him a pivotal figure in Indonesian literature and post-colonial thought.
